Pickerington, Ohio Facts
| Area | 9.8 mi² |
| Population | 21,055 |
| Male Population | 10,242 (48.6%) |
| Female Population | 10,813 (51.4%) |
| Population change (1975 to 2020) | +6.9% |
| Population change (2000 to 2020) | +36.3% |
| Median Age | 32.8 years (Male: 31.9, Female: 33.6) |
| GDP per capita (PPP) | $82,395 (2022) |
| Area Codes | 614, 740 |
| Neighborhoods | South Columbus, Pickerington, Independence Village, East Columbus, NW |
| Local Time | |
| Timezone | Eastern Daylight Time |
| Lat & Lng | 39.88423, -82.75350 |
| Zip Codes | 43147 |

Pickerington, Ohio Median Age
Median Age: 32.8 years
| Location | Median Age | Median Age (Female) | Median Age (Male)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pickerington, Ohio | 32.8 yrs | 33.6 yrs | 31.9 yrs |
| Ohio | 38.8 yrs | 40.2 yrs | 37.4 yrs |
| United States | 37.4 yrs | 38.7 yrs | 36.1 yrs |
Pickerington, Ohio Population Density
Population Density: 2,154 / mi²
| Location | Population | Area | Density |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pickerington, Ohio | 21,055 | 9.77 sq mi | 2,154 / mi² |
| Ohio | 11.5 million | 44,825.6 sq mi | 257 / mi² |
| United States | 321.6 million | 3,796,740.8 sq mi | 84.7 / mi² |

Pickerington, Ohio
Pickerington is a city in Fairfield and Franklin counties in the central region of the U.S. state of Ohio. It was founded in 1815 as Jacksonville. Pickerington was known as Jacksonville until 1827, when the citizens petitioned the state legislature t..
